WebJan 13, 2024 · What's a Water Softener? A water softener will help you remove the minerals that cause water to be hard. Typically, water softeners consist of a tank that you connect to the water supply line. It's pre-filled with resin beads, and the top tank is often filled with potassium chloride or salt pellets.
